A closer look at Organic / Biomorphic

Organic / Biomorphic feels grown rather than drawn. It's a calm, living style, and a requirements document built in it reads as something that took shape naturally, with soft edges, generous air, and nothing forced into a straight line. Even the grid feels like it settled there rather than being ruled.

Abstract blob and cell forms drift across the page in flowing curves, coloured in a moss, ochre and clay palette that never strays into anything synthetic. A serif carries the text, lending a hand-set, considered quality that suits the shapes around it, and space is used generously rather than filled.

A detail from the Organic / Biomorphic example

It's the right choice for brands rooted in nature, wellbeing, sustainability or craft, where the requirements document should feel considered and unhurried rather than engineered, a fit for anyone whose story is about growth rather than output. It also suits brands wary of looking too polished, who'd rather read as genuine.

The particular skill of this style in a requirements document is restraint. The biomorphic forms stay abstract rather than becoming literal leaves or plants, which keeps the page feeling sophisticated instead of decorative, and lets the palette do the emotional work instead of imagery.
